Travel Impressions Expands Ambassadors Program

beach footprintTravel Impressions (TI) reports it  will officially kick-off its second annual TI Ambassadors Program on Oct. 15, 2013. While the inaugural season featured eight supplier partners, the upcoming program will be expanded to include 10 of Travel Impressions’ resort and destination partners. The move will provide travel agents with additional opportunities to become recognized brand advocates, TI says.

The Ambassador application period will open on Aug. 12, 2013. Agencies interested in TI Ambassadorship must submit their applications no later than Aug. 26, 2013.

One noteworthy change to the 2013-2014 program from last year is that TI Ambassadors will be selected on the agency level rather than an individual agent level. Individual agents are encouraged to collaborate with owners/managers and apply as an agency, TI said. 

Participating suppliers include All-Inclusive Hard Rock Hotels, AMResorts, Bahia Principe Hotels & Resorts, Cancun, El Dorado Spa Resorts & Hotels and Azul Hotels, by Karisma, Excellence Group Luxury Hotels & Resorts, IBEROSTAR Hotels & Resorts, Melia Hotels International, Palace Resorts/Le Blanc Spa Resort and RIU Hotels & Resorts.

"The TI Ambassador Program targets savvy travel agencies who actively use social media to further their sales and marketing goals," said John Hanratty, chief operating officer for Travel Impressions.

"The program taps into the enthusiasm, knowledge and expertise travel agencies bring to the table by partnering them with the properties and destinations for which they are most passionate. The resulting synergistic exposure is particularly impacting as it draws on the agency's position as a trusted travel counselor," noted Hanratty.
